This very special part in the north of Provence is rich with
truffles, lavender, honey and wonderful wines.
Even the food tastes and smells of sunshine!

We'll picnic in some of the most beautiful settings you can imagine, play petanque, glass of pastis in hand, in the shadow of a 14th century church.

We'll learn about olive oil and nougat making, and shop for pique-nique fare in the colourful Vaucluse markets.

Wander through medieval villages classified among the most beautiful in France, explore Roman ruins including the famed theatre of Orange and the Pont-du-Gard, and follow trails to visit some of the stoniest vineyards in the world - Gigondas, Beaumes-de-Venise, Chateauneuf-du-Pape, Côtes-du-Rhône - We'll try them all!

Our routes are cunningly planned to reduce hill climbing to a minimum, unless, of course, you want the challenge!
We'll even picnic high on Mont Ventoux, of Tour de France fame, but never fear, the majority of us will ascend by bus before savouring the descent.
